MaRussiya [10]

Answer:

Text to world connections.

Explanation:

Text to text are connections that reminds a reader about a detail in a text based on previously read text

Text to world connections are those connections between events in a story and things previously read or seen in the real (outside) world.

Therefore, the connection made if a reader remembers the Grecian history when reading the text is text to world connections.
